Dimensional analysis
• Dimensional analysis uses conversion factors to convert from one unit to another.
• Also called Factor Label (and railroad tracks)
• You do this in your head all the time– How many quarters are in 4 dollars?

Basic SI UnitsQuantity Base unit
Length meter (m)
Mass gram (g)
Time second (s)
Volume Liter (L)
Temperature Kelvin (K) or Celsius (C)
Amount of substance mole (mol)
Heat & Energy joule (J)

Some Useful Conversions
Length:1 in = 2.54 cm1 mi = 5280 ft
Volume:1 cm3 = 1 mL1 L = 1.06 qt
Weight:1 kg = 2.2 lb16 oz = 1 lb1 ton = 2000 lb

Temperature
• 20°C = 293 K• 373 K = 100 °C
Use both the Kelvin and Celsius scale, to convert
Celsius + 273 = Kelvin
Kelvin -273 = Celsius
